RELIABLE EVENT PLANNING SOLUTIONS BY YOUR EVENT SOURCE CHARLOTTE FOR ANY OCCASION.

Reliable Event Planning Solutions by Your Event Source Charlotte for Any Occasion.

Reliable Event Planning Solutions by Your Event Source Charlotte for Any Occasion.

Blog Article

The Future of Occasion Sourcing: Exactly How It Improves System Efficiency and Scalability



As organizations progressively adopt event-driven designs, the future of occasion sourcing stands to improve how systems carry out and range. The immutability of occasions offers one-of-a-kind opportunities for maximizing data retrieval and lowering latency.




Comprehending Occasion Sourcing



Occasion sourcing, a standard that has obtained substantial traction in contemporary software application style, describes the method of recording all modifications to an application's state as a sequence of events. This strategy contrasts with traditional techniques where state modifications are usually stored as present values in a data source. Rather, event sourcing highlights the value of the background of state changes, allowing systems to reconstruct the present state by repeating events.


Each occasion represents an unique modification and is unalterable, making sure that the system can keep a reputable audit trail. This immutability not only improves information honesty however also helps with temporal queries, allowing designers to examine historical states and transitions. Events can be enriched with metadata, offering context regarding how and why a state change took place.


Occasion sourcing inherently sustains the principles of domain-driven design by lining up the version carefully with service processes. This method promotes a much better understanding of the domain while making it possible for an extra receptive system design (your event source charlotte). As applications progress, occasion sourcing offers a durable framework for managing complicated state changes and enhances overall system strength, paving the method for extra sophisticated and adaptable software program options


Benefits of Occasion Sourcing



One of the key advantages of taking on event sourcing is its ability to give a thorough audit trail of modifications within an application. This audit trail records every state shift as an unalterable series of events, permitting developers to map the history of changes easily. Debugging and understanding system behavior ends up being much more workable, as each event can be replayed to rebuild past states.


In addition, occasion sourcing fosters improved information integrity. Considering that every modification is recorded as an occasion, the threat of information loss is reduced, and systems can be restored to any time. This attribute shows important in scenarios where information uniformity is extremely important.


Furthermore, event sourcing advertises decoupling of parts within a system. By relying upon events for communication, various solutions can develop independently, improving versatility and maintainability. This architectural style sustains scalability, allowing organizations to deal with enhanced loads extra effectively.




Last but not least, occasion sourcing supports complicated service procedures and operations by allowing event-driven designs to thrive. This ability to anchor version elaborate interactions supplies a strong foundation for developing durable and receptive systems that adapt to transforming business requirements.


Enhancing System Efficiency



Reliable system efficiency is crucial for any type of application, and embracing occasion sourcing can substantially improve this element. By leveraging a design that catches all modifications as a sequence of occasions, occasion sourcing allows for maximized performance in different ways.


your event source charlotteyour event source charlotte
In addition, event sourcing cultivates a much more all-natural splitting up of issues within the application architecture. By separating the create and check out models, systems can be fine-tuned for performance. As an example, while the event shop takes care of the perseverance of events, the read versions can be maximized independently, you could try this out permitting tailored information access patterns that enhance general efficiency.


In addition, the immutability of events in event sourcing methods that systems can utilize caching much more effectively. Hence, occasion sourcing stands out as a powerful method to boosting system performance in contemporary applications.


Scalability in Event-Driven Architectures



Scaling applications efficiently commonly rests on taking on event-driven designs, which inherently sustain the vibrant nature of modern systems. By decoupling elements and making use of asynchronous interaction, these styles help with the independent scaling of solutions based on demand. This adaptability permits organizations to allocate resources more effectively, resulting in improved responsiveness and reduced latency.


In event-driven systems, occasions function as triggers that initiate procedures throughout distributed components, enabling horizontal scalability. your event source charlotte. As workloads boost, extra circumstances of services can be released without interrupting existing performance. In addition, making use of event lines assists handle spikes in traffic, enabling smooth integration of new services or components as needed.


your event source charlotteyour event source charlotte
Additionally, event sourcing matches scalability by supplying a trusted device for reconstructing system states via a log of occasions. This not just boosts fault tolerance but additionally sustains information uniformity across distributed solutions, which is essential in a scalable design.


Future Trends in Event Sourcing



your event source charlotteyour event source charlotte
Welcoming occasion sourcing as a foundational architectural pattern is positioned to form the future of system layout and information monitoring substantially. As organizations increasingly look for to utilize real-time data for decision-making, occasion sourcing offers a robust service by capturing state changes as a series of occasions. This fad is prepared for to enhance system performance through improved information access and handling capabilities.




One remarkable future fad is the integration of event sourcing with artificial knowledge and artificial intelligence. By evaluating historic occasion information, companies can obtain workable insights, bring about automated decision-making processes. Furthermore, the rise of cloud-native architectures will promote the usage of event sourcing, enabling scalable and resistant systems that can efficiently manage rising and fall work.


Additionally, the adoption of microservices will certainly remain to drive the evolution of occasion sourcing. This architectural approach allows groups to develop and deploy solutions separately, cultivating agility and lowering time-to-market (your event source charlotte). As organizations focus on data integrity and auditability, occasion sourcing will solidify its duty redirected here in compliance and regulative frameworks


Conclusion



The future of event sourcing holds promise for substantial enhancements in system efficiency and scalability. By leveraging asynchronous communication and decoupled parts, applications can efficiently handle high information volumes, resulting in improved responsiveness and minimized traffic jams. The immutability of occasions not only supports reliable caching and fast information access yet also adds to reduce latency. As event-driven styles continue to progress, the capacity for enhanced efficiency and scalability within facility systems ends up being increasingly attainable.

Report this page